#e83f38 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e83f38 is composed of 91% red, 24.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 75.9%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 2.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 56.5%. #e83f38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7e70 with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#e83f38

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0201 is the darkest color, while #fefa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e83f38

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938e8d is the less saturated color, while #f92f27 is the most saturated one.
